What are the 3 different types of ad networks?

Different Types of Ad Networks Vertical networks: Ad networks that are topic-specific, such as fashion, automotive, or business. Premium networks: Ad networks that offer inventory from popular publishers. Inventory-specific networks: Ad networks that provide a specific type of ad inventory, such as video or mobile.

What is the biggest advertising platform?

Google
To put that in context, Google is still by far the largest ad platform, taking 37.1\% of market share, while Facebook comes in second place, taking 20.6\% of market share. However, by 2020 Google and Facebook will see their market shares decline by a few points each as Amazon continues to grow its ad share.

How do ad networks make money?

Ad networks make money by selling inventory at a higher price than they paid for it, and they often make a percentage off every transaction. Ad networks help advertisers scale their ad buys and target a particular audience or vertical.

Is Facebook an ad network?

Robert Galbraith/Reuters Facebook is a mobile advertising machine. The social network also feeds ads to a bunch of other apps and mobile websites through what it calls the “Facebook Audience Network.” “FAN” lets brands extend their Facebook ad campaigns off of Facebook, using the same targeting data as they use on it.
